So i just installed the evo stlye hood made out of fiberglass and the fitment is not great.....i did my research.. and here is what i did
shaved the side of the hood where the strut will hit.
removed the radaitor cap but didnt cause any rubbing
i lined up everything but still doesnt fit well on the passenger side
i had to move up the latch about half an inch in order to have the hood securely closed...didnt want it to fly up in my windsheild...
trimed the sides..ohh yea where the nuts touch the car i thought it was rubbing so i went to town
